Package org.drools.mvelcompiler
Class CompiledExpressionResult
- java.lang.Object
-
- org.drools.mvelcompiler.CompiledExpressionResult
-
- All Implemented Interfaces:
CompiledResult
public class CompiledExpressionResult extends Object implements CompiledResult
-
-
Constructor Summary
Constructors Constructor Description CompiledExpressionResult(com.github.javaparser.ast.expr.Expression expression, Optional<Type> type)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description com.github.javaparser.ast.expr.ExpressiongetExpression()Optional<Type>getType()Set<String>getUsedBindings()StringresultAsString()CompiledExpressionResultsetUsedBindings(Set<String> usedBindings)com.github.javaparser.ast.stmt.BlockStmtstatementResults()
-
-
-
Method Detail
-
getExpression
public com.github.javaparser.ast.expr.Expression getExpression()
-
resultAsString
public String resultAsString()
-
statementResults
public com.github.javaparser.ast.stmt.BlockStmt statementResults()
- Specified by:
statementResultsin interfaceCompiledResult
-
getUsedBindings
public Set<String> getUsedBindings()
- Specified by:
getUsedBindingsin interfaceCompiledResult
-
setUsedBindings
public CompiledExpressionResult setUsedBindings(Set<String> usedBindings)
-
-